Safari Club International,
with more than 40,000 members in over 85 countries, is a
non-profit organization that promotes wildlife conservation
and education, hunting as a wildlife management tool, humanitarian
services for people in need, and advocates on behalf of
hunters for the preservation of hunting traditions worldwide.

Code of Ethics
"Recognizing my responsibilities to wildlife, habitat, and
future generations, I pledge:
1. To conduct myself in the field so as
to make a positive contribution to wildlife and ecosystems.
2. To improve my skills as a woodsman and marksman to ensure
humane harvesting of wildlife.
3. To comply with all game laws, in the spirit of Fair Chase,
and to influence my companions accordingly.
4. To accept my responsibility to provide all possible assistance
to game law enforcement officers.
5. To waste no opportunity to teach young people the full
meaning of this code of ethics.
6. To reflect in word and behavior only credit upon that
fraternity of sportsman, and to demonstrate abiding respect
for game, habitat, and property where I am privileged to
hunt."
